    It took two years of studio time, cost half a million pounds and has never been hailed as their strongest album, yet Get Ready was in many ways a high-water mark forNew Order.     “Get Ready is a more rock album, but we’re really just returning to our Joy Division roots, using more guitar,” announced a rejuvenated Sumner upon the album’s release on 27 August 2001.     After an eight-year absence, New Order came out swinging on Get Ready’s opening track Crystal, one of their all-time best singles.     Get Ready reached No 6 on the UK chart, selling 300,000 copies worldwide after Republic’s 3 million, blamed by the band’s label on illegal file-sharing. Despite the massive gulf in sales, Corgan, who played guitar on the subsequent US tour, enthused to The Guardian “They’re up there withThe Beatles.
